Once you have your protein powder, the only other ingredients you’ll need are almond butter, milk (I use almond milk), banana, and ice. Simple! Just blend everything up in a blender and you have a filling breakfast or snack ready to go!

- ¾ cup ice cubes
- ½ cup unsweetened almond milk
- ½ banana
- 1 scoop chocolate protein powder
- 2 teaspoons almond butter
- Place all ingredients in a blender.
- Blend until smooth.
